Former DLA tax partner joins Greenberg Traurig in Silicon Valley

The international law firm Greenberg Traurig, LLP is pleased to announce that Christopher R. Haunschild has joined the tax department in the firm’s Silicon Valley office. Prior to joining Greenberg Traurig, he was with DLA Piper.

“It is a pleasure to welcome Chris to our growing Tax practice. He will be instrumental in helping our clients reach their goals,” stated Matthew Gorson, President of Greenberg Traurig.

Haunschild has practiced international tax law since 1994, focusing on structuring and implementing cross-border mergers, acquisitions and divestitures, post-merger and post-acquisition integration, repatriation planning, tax rate reduction, global supply chain restructuring, intellectural property migration, principal company structuring, Subpart F planning and foreign tax credit optimization. He routinely advises U.S. multinational companies on the tax and transfer pricing consequences of their operations and proposed transactions in Asia, Europe and Latin America.

In addition to his technical training, Haunschild possesses a wealth of practical experience. He has served as the Vice President of Global Tax at a Fortune 200 high-tech company in Silicon Valley and has negotiated tax settlements and rulings directly with senior tax officials around the world. Haunschild is sensitive to the financial reporting consequences of tax planning and understands what senior management seeks to achieve from their company’s tax projects.

“We are thrilled that Chris has joined forces with us,” said Heather J. Meeker, Co-Managing Shareholder of the firm’s Silicon Valley office. “He has a great understanding of international tax laws and a wealth of knowledge and experience.”

William J. Goines, Co-Managing Shareholder of the firm’s Silicon Valley office stated, ”Chris will add a strong, unique talent to the team and will enhance the depth of service we provide our clients.”

Haunschild received his B.A. from Trinity University, his J.D. from University of Tulsa College of Law and Master of Laws (LL.M) in Taxation and International Taxation from New York University School of Law. He is admitted to practice in California and New York.
